It’s already April and it's time to prepare for the summer. This is what the professional poker player Daniel Negreanu decided to do and told about plans for the next WSOP and other summer events.
Daniel Plans to Spend $2,000,000 on Buy-ins
Daniel is no longer a boy and said he was not going to participate in two parallel tournaments, as he used to do five years ago when he was arguing with Phil Ivey. Now his goal is to create a tight tournament schedule for the summer and strictly adhere to it.
Recent years after the completion of the WSOP Main Event, nothing interesting happened for the high rollers, but now Negreanu says that he will find something to do. Aria and Bellagio casinos join the race and will also offer expensive tournaments.
In general, Daniel planned to take part in 39 tournaments at the WSOP. Negreanu’s total budget for the World Series of Poker buy-ins will be about $1.4 million, and if you consider that he is going to play Super High Roller Bowl in May, as well as high roller tournaments in Aria for $25,000 and a bunch of limit games, this sum is approximately $2,000,000.
From June 1, ending in mid-July, Daniel will take just five days off from poker, the rest of his days are waiting for an endless tournament grind. In addition, he promises to make video blogs, where he will tell about his successes and difficult hands.
